Snap-On
Brushless Hip Shooter
Model: CT861
Historical Reference
This product is included for historical comparison and is not currently recommended for purchase.
Made 102 ft-lb working torque, 216 ft-lb max torque. Prefers reverse operation but starts to flatline and run out of steam over 200 ft-lb. Has excellent toggle trigger that's 'the jam' but performance beaten by Milwaukee for less money.
